Why Palatine’s Climate & Housing Affect Chimney Cleaning
Palatine sits on flat, open northwest-suburban terrain with no natural wind break. Prevailing winter winds from the northwest drive freezing rain and ice directly into chimney crowns and cap seams at full force, accelerating crown cracking and water infiltration on exposed north and west faces. This isn’t theoretical - we see it every March when homeowners call about water stains on their ceilings or bricks spalling off the chimney shoulder.
The repeated freeze-thaw cycling through a Palatine winter means water that enters a compromised crown in November has typically forced significant spalling or mortar joint failure by the spring inspection season. Meanwhile, the housing stock itself creates a second layer of risk. Palatine’s residential core was built almost entirely between 1965 and 1985, flooding the market with factory-built zero-clearance fireplace systems now roughly double their engineered lifespan. Chimney cleaning calls here disproportionately turn into Level II inspection findings of cracked refractory panels, failed air-cooling channels, and deteriorated chase covers that mandate full unit replacement - a pattern far less common in newer-build neighbors to the west.
In Palatine’s high-turnover resale market near the Metra line, home inspectors routinely flag fireplace systems as “beyond serviceable life,” triggering mandatory Level II chimney inspections at closing. We do a notably high volume of these pre-sale inspections compared to lower-turnover suburbs. The 1970s-era flexible corrugated metal liners inside many original prefab units frequently show collapse or separation that voids any safe-use certification. What begins as a routine cleaning estimate becomes a full replacement job - and we’d rather find that in an inspection than leave it unspoken.

The National Fire Protection Association recommends annual inspection, with cleaning as needed based on creosote accumulation. In Palatine, we find that factory-built fireplaces from the 1960s-1980s housing stock often need more frequent attention due to degraded combustion efficiency and liner deterioration. If you burn wood regularly, schedule annually; if your system is original to a 1970s ranch or split-level, call for inspection even if you haven’t used it recently.

For Palatine’s 40-60 year old prefabricated units, replacement is frequently the more economical long-term choice. Factory-built systems have engineered lifespans of 20-25 years, and replacement parts for discontinued Heatilator, Majestic, and Superior models are often unavailable. We document the condition with photos and a plain-English verdict so you can make an informed decision - no pressure, just facts.
